Frontend Engineer (React/Next.js/TypeScript)


London 5 days per week in office | Full-time | 2–5 years’ experience


About the Company

I am working with an early-stage, venture-backed energy technology startup that is building the intelligence layer for the electrification of real estate and infrastructure. Their platform uses geospatial analytics and machine learning to help investors, developers and operators identify the best opportunities for deploying EV charging, solar and battery storage, accelerating the global energy transition. They are backed by leading European VCs and led by a team with experience at Tesla, Palantir and CBRE. Having recently raised a significant pre-seed round, they are now scaling their engineering team.


The Role

My client is looking for a talented Frontend Engineer with strong experience in React, Next.js and TypeScript. This person will design and build the user interfaces that power their platform, from exploratory data tools to interactive dashboards. A major part of the role will be contributing to a frontend migration project that modernises existing codebases.

The position is based on-site in London, 5 days per week, working closely with product managers, designers and backend engineers.


What You’ll Do

• Develop high-quality, scalable frontends using React, Next.js and TypeScript

• Contribute to the design and implementation of a major migration project, modernising existing frontend codebases

• Collaborate with product managers, designers and backend engineers to build seamless user experiences

• Optimise application performance and ensure responsiveness across devices

• Write clean, maintainable and testable code, following best practices


About You

• 2–5 years’ experience as a frontend or fullstack engineer

• Strong expertise in React, Next.js and TypeScript

• Solid understanding of frontend architecture, state management and UI/UX principles

• Strong problem-solving skills and an outcome-oriented mindset

• A degree from a leading university in Computer Science, Engineering or a related field (preferred but not essential)

• Excited by working in a fast-paced startup environment and motivated by the mission to accelerate electrification
